首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从数据库中删除产品并重新装入库存

是一个常见的操作,可以通过以下步骤完成:

  1. 首先,需要连接到数据库。数据库是用于存储和管理数据的系统,常见的数据库管理系统包括MySQL、Oracle、SQL Server等。连接数据库可以使用相应的数据库连接工具或编程语言提供的数据库连接库。
  2. 一旦连接到数据库,可以执行删除操作。删除操作通常使用SQL语句来完成。SQL是结构化查询语言,用于与数据库进行交互。删除操作可以使用DELETE语句,通过指定条件来删除符合条件的记录。例如,可以使用以下SQL语句删除产品表中ID为1的产品:
  3. 一旦连接到数据库,可以执行删除操作。删除操作通常使用SQL语句来完成。SQL是结构化查询语言,用于与数据库进行交互。删除操作可以使用DELETE语句,通过指定条件来删除符合条件的记录。例如,可以使用以下SQL语句删除产品表中ID为1的产品:
  4. 这将从产品表中删除ID为1的产品。
  5. 删除产品后,需要重新装入库存。库存是指企业或组织中存储的产品或物品的数量。重新装入库存可以通过插入新的记录来完成。插入操作使用INSERT语句,将新的数据插入到表中。例如,可以使用以下SQL语句将新产品插入到产品表中:
  6. 删除产品后,需要重新装入库存。库存是指企业或组织中存储的产品或物品的数量。重新装入库存可以通过插入新的记录来完成。插入操作使用INSERT语句,将新的数据插入到表中。例如,可以使用以下SQL语句将新产品插入到产品表中:
  7. 这将在产品表中插入一个新的产品,其ID为1,名称为"New Product",数量为10。
  8. 在完成删除和重新装入库存的操作后,可以关闭数据库连接,释放资源。

这个操作的优势是可以快速、方便地删除数据库中的产品,并重新装入库存。这在产品下架、库存更新等场景中非常有用。

这个操作适用于各种行业和领域,包括电商、零售、物流等。无论是线上商店还是实体店铺,都需要管理产品和库存。通过从数据库中删除产品并重新装入库存,可以及时更新库存信息,确保准确的库存管理。

腾讯云提供了多个与数据库相关的产品和服务,包括云数据库MySQL、云数据库Redis、云数据库MongoDB等。这些产品提供了可靠、高性能的数据库解决方案,适用于各种规模和需求的应用。您可以访问腾讯云官网了解更多信息:

请注意,以上链接仅供参考,具体的产品选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

数据库测试场景实践总结

来源:https://viptest.net 1、数据库超时测试场景验证 可以通过锁表方式进行,比如测试库存预占写数据库失败,写入SSDB的测试场景 ,可以进行如下操作: ---锁数据库表---...unlock tables ; 2、应用锁表SSDB测试场景验证 应用锁定数据表,写入数据库失败,数据库对象写入SSDB,通过SSDB重试,数据表解锁后,通过SSDB写入数据库正确 测试过程,需要开发配合打断点...,验证写入SSDB功能正常 常用SSDB命令: (1)SSDB服务器,连接客户端登 登录SSDB服务器,进入SSDB安装目录下的tools目录,执行命令 ..../ssdb-cli -h 192.168.154.149 -p 8888 (2)查询队列数量 ,库存预占的SSDB队列名为 sk_ocpy_asyncdb_queue qsize sk_ocpy_asyncdb_queue...SSDB信息内容 qget sk_ocpy_asyncdb_queue 0 3、SSDB服务重启 应用服务,使用SSDB写流水库,SSDB服务经常会自动断,这时便无法正常写入流水库;需要重启SSDB的服务,并重库存预占的服务

52420
  • 为什么上了ERP系统后业务还毫无起色?

    在论证ERP的价值时,ERP给企业带来的最大希望就是,从公司接到订单直到订单的完成这个过程,ERP可以起到很好的促进作用。这也就是我们为什么称ERP为后台系统的原因。...财务做财务的,库存库存的,即使出现了问题也是其它部门的问题。...如果你能够使用ERP系统去促进你业务流程的话,比如订单处理,产品的生产、运输和结账,那么你就会看到这个软件的价值了。...实际上,由于新装了人们都不熟悉的系统,而替换掉了人们已经熟练了的软件,最后导致的是更低工作效率。 版权归原作者所有,如有侵权请联系删除。...免责声明:本文所用视频、图片、文字如涉及作品版权问题,请第一时间告知,我们将根据您提供的证明材料确认版权并按国家标准支付稿酬或立即删除内容!

    47750

    干货 | 1分钟售票8万张!门票抢票背后的技术思考

    例如:优惠、立减; 2)合并重复的 IO(SOA/ Redis/DB),减少一次请求相同数据的重复访问。...1)缓存击穿 描述:缓存击穿是指数据库中有,缓存没有。...限购就是限制购买,规定购买的数量,往往是一些特价和降价的产品,为了防止恶意抢购所采取的一种商业手段。...缺点:热点资源,热门日期,扣减库存行级锁时间变长,接口RT变长,处理能力下降。 2)使用分布式缓存,在分布式缓存预减库存,减少数据库访问。 秒杀商品异步扣减,消除DB峰值,非秒杀走正常流程。...,在优化过程,不断地思考和落地技术细节,沉淀核心技术,以最终达到让用户预订及园顺畅,体验良好的目标。

    1.6K10

    简单的php购物车代码

    本文介绍一个php实现的购物车代码,功能实现完整,具有一定的参考价值 这里我们为你提供个简单的php购物车代码,增加购物产品与发生购买了,在商城开发,这个功能是少不了的 具体分析如下: 对购物车里商品的操作大体上有以下几个...:添加商品,删除商品,以及提交订单; 方法本质是:把session存入array,对array进行增加、删除、修改操作,array的每一组记录都是一个商品的信息(个数,价格等); 解决购物车的思路是用...购物车的操作流程:首先,登录到网站浏览商品;然后,购买指定的商品,进入购物车页面,在该页面可以实现更改商品数量、删除商品、清空购物车、继续购物等;最后,生成订单,提交订单等操作。...php //这里显示的是 购物车有多少产品,和产品的总价格 $ann=array(); if(!...用户账户扣除本次购买的总价格 //ii. 从商品库存扣除本次每种商品的购买数量 //iii.

    2.9K10

    小商店0到1的系统能力构建之路

    小商店自立项以来,除了产品形态上在不断迭代,开发上的核心目标也在跟随着产品战略而有不同的侧重,本文主要围绕以下几个产品战略阶段展开讨论。 ?...我们假设理想情况下,DB里面所有数据有加了完美缓存,那么理论上DB的GET次数为GETuv(多少个key就访问多少次,同一个key第二次访问会被cache挡住)+SETpv(数据更新时,我们会删除缓存,...(2)平滑租借:tdsql借出,到入账redis的过程,如何规避这个短暂不可交易状态?...03 商家驻 当系统趋于稳定后,我们的部分精力会去思考如何辅助产品做好这个项目。 电商场景下,商家驻影响因素:拉力与门槛。而我们是否可以技术的角度去辅助产品降低门槛呢? ?...云时代,我们需要怎样的数据库? ? 大数据AI时代的产品修炼之路:A/B测试 ? 让我知道你在看 ?

    1.3K10

    SAP最佳业务实践:外委生产(249)-2需求计划

    3(计划行) 创建MRP清单1(MRP 清单) 计划模式3(删除并重新创建计划数据) 调度2(按提前期排产和能力计划) 处理控制参数也计划未更改组件W (删除标识) 保存显示结果W (删除标识) 显示物料清单...W (删除标识) 模拟方式W (删除标识) ?...MD04库存/需求清单评估 需求计划执行后,显示库存/需求清单成品 MTS (F249) 的库存/需求状况。 已经执行需求计划。 1....对于成品:生产入库仓库,跑MRP计划订单的生产入库库存地,就是此仓储地点。 对于原材料:设置生产仓储地点,则MRP跑出的上阶计划订单中原材料组件发料的库存地,就是此生产仓储地点 1....菜单,选择 (NWBC: 更多…®)环境 ®总需求显示。在这里,您可以一眼就看到该物料的所有计划独立需求和对应的分配状态。

    1.4K90

    分布式事务实战

    1.2传统单机数据库事务 在传统单体应用架构,我们的业务数据通常都是存储在一个数据库的,应用的各个模块对数据库直接进行操作。在这种场景,事务是由数据库提供的基于ACID特性来保证的。...本次讲解会结合一个实际案例:购物系统的下单流程和删除产品流程来分别讲解saga模式和tcc模式如何使用的。...下单流程包括:点击下单、查询库存、支付、更新库存;订单应用作为起始服务,调用库存应用和产品应用,这两个应用对应的服务作为参与服务(子事务),在订单应用下单,订单应用使用rest template向产品应用发起调用校验产品库存...try方法参一致,否则启动时会报错(alpha-server找不到补偿方法) 3.2.3 tcc模式代码编写 下面我们会以删除库存流程来讲解tcc模式是如何编写代码的。...删除库存流程:由产品应用发起(分布式事务起始),调用库存应用删除对应产品库存信息(tcc子事务)。 ? 本次调用使用的是feign的方式,因此需要在产品应用的pom文件添加相应的依赖: ? 1.

    78720

    MongoDB数据库新手入门

    to install system services 权限不足 解决办法: 1.默认C盘安装路径 2.其它磁盘根目录,D:/mongodb/ 配置环境变量 bin目录添加到path环境变量里面 创建数据库存储文件...D:/mongoDatabase/ 指定数据库存储文件 mongod --dbpath D:/mongoDatabase/ 启动 mongo 或者指定连接本地数据库 mongo 127.0.0.1...db.dropDatabase() 删除数据库 db.createCollection("runoob") 使用SQL命令强迫关闭mongo服务 use admin db.shutdownServer...linux 安装mongodb,配置以及使用 安装 官网下载tar包,上传到服务器目录: /usr/local/mongodb 解压,tar -zxvf mongodb-linux-x86_64-xxx 并重命名.../mongod --config /usr/local/mongodb/etc/mongodb.conf 方式二 把上面的命令写成脚本文件,我把它放到 ~/restartMongo ,如下: cd ~

    38530

    了解图形数据库_图形数据库neo4j

    为什么图形数据库对您很重要? 想象一下存储在当地连锁餐厅的数据。如果您要跟踪,则将客户信息存储在一个数据库,将您提供的项目存储在另一个数据库,以及您在第三个表中进行的销售。...当我想了解我销售的产品,订购库存以及了解我最好的客户是谁时,这很好。但缺少的是结缔组织以及项目之间的连接以及数据库的功能,这些功能可以让我充分利用它。...图形数据库存储相同类型的数据,但也能够存储事物之间的链接。约翰购买了很多百事可乐,杰克与瓦莱丽结婚,买了不同的饮料。我没有必要运行JOIN来了解我应该如何向每个客户推销产品。...是的,可以在传统的关系数据库管理系统(RDBMS)创建这些链接。但是,要在传统数据库执行这些任务,数据库管理员必须努力维护唯一键并重建与JOIN的关系。...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除

    83040

    vivo 全球商城:商品系统架构设计与实践

    3.2 高性能 多级缓存 为了提升查询速度,降低数据库的压力,我们采用多级缓存的方式,接口接入热点缓存组件,动态探测热点数据,如果是热点则直接本地获取,如果不是热点则直接redis获取。...读写分离 数据库采用读写分离架构,主库进行更新操作,库负责查询操作。 接口限流 接入限流组件, 直接操作数据库的接口会进行限流,防止因为突发流量、或者不规范调用导致数据库压力增加,影响其他接口。...不过早期也踩过一些坑: 1、商品列表查询造成redis key过多,导致redis内存不够的风险 由于是列表查询,进行缓存的时候是对参进行hash,获取唯一的key,由于参商品较多,某些场景下参是随时变化的...方案一:循环参列表,每次redis获取数据,然后返回; [e0f13d0cda81498bb30aa523efe0dc8e~tplv-k3u1fbpfcp-zoom-1.image] 这个方案解决了...对于写请求采用先操作数据库,再删除缓存。 2、由于库存剥离出去,维护入口还是在商品系统,这就导致存在跨库操作,平常的单库事务无法解决。

    93740

    ubuntu上docker卸载重装

    (docker images -q) 3、当要删除的iamges和其他的镜像有关联而无法删除时 可通过 -f 参数强制删除 docker rmi -f 大家好,又见面了,我是你们的朋友全栈君。...清理docker并重装 1、删除容器 1)首先需要停止所有的容器 docker stop $(docker ps -a -q) 2)删除所有的容器(只删除单个时把后面的变量改为image id即可...) docker rm $(docker ps -a -q) 2、删除镜像 1)查看host的镜像 docker images 2)删除指定id的镜像 docker rmi image id...3)删除全部的images docker rmi $(docker images -q) 3、当要删除的iamges和其他的镜像有关联而无法删除时 可通过 -f 参数强制删除 docker rmi...apt-get purge docker-engine sudo apt-get autoremove –purge docker-engine rm -rf /var/lib/docker 重新装

    2.9K30

    什么是永续盘存系统?

    库存管理软件和流程允许实时更新库存数量。通常,这意味着员工使用条形码扫描仪来记录发生的销售,购买或退货。员工将这些信息输入到不断调整的数据库,该数据库可跟踪每个更改。...他们将鸡检入时将它们热码头上卸下。结果,尽管它仍然可以食用且安全,但煮熟后变得非常难看。他们学会了将库存带入冰箱,然后对他们的库存进行检。他们必须根据产品的需求调整程序和系统。”...在永续盘存系统下如何跟踪库存? 永久库存系统会在交易(例如销售或收据)发生时通过更新产品数据库来跟踪货物。...没有计算机的库存系统,将很难手动跟踪企业的每笔交易,尤其是在销售许多产品的公司。例如,一家零售大盒子商店有数千种产品。它的供应链每天提供其他货物的交付,然后员工将其扫描到他们的数据库。...当客户购买其中一种产品时,数据库会在数量上少列出一种产品。 该系统取决于正确的库存控制程序,例如,系统需要确保员工迅速扫描任何新库存

    1.6K20

    基于代码实操SpringBoot、Redis、LUA秒杀系统!

    Redis等缓存,为了保证数据库与Redis的一致性,多是采用“修改后删除”方案。...但是这个方案在更高并发情况下,如C10K、C10M等,在修改数据库删除Redis内容的一瞬间,大量查询并发会传导至数据库,产生异常。 这种情况,SPU详情这种接口就坚决不能与数据库连接起来。...步骤应该是: 1、B端管理系统操作数据库(这个并发不会高)。 2、数据入库后,发送消息给MQ。 3、相关处理程序在接收到订阅的MQ的Topic后,数据库取出信息,放入Redis。...4、相关服务接口只Redis取数据。 代码实现 在实际项目中,建议将ToC端的秒杀产品相关接口组合为一个微服务,product-server。售卖接口组合为一个微服务,order-server。...在从product_one_stock_商品IDlpop出数值,如果还有库存,必会返回1,有库存,否则就是nil,无库存。 2、可售多件。之前讲过,不再描述。

    72331

    Oracle文件系统迁移到ASM存储

    环境:RHEL 6.4 + Oracle 11.2.0.4 需求:数据库存储由文件系统迁移到ASM 数据库存储迁移到ASM磁盘组 1.1 编辑参数文件指定新的控制文件路径 1.2 启动数据库到nomount...1.8 迁移重做日志文件 1.9 服务器参数文件,并重数据库 1.10 验证各文件存储位置 Reference 数据库存储迁移到ASM磁盘组 实验环境前期准备: 文件系统数据库模拟环境《Oracle...SELECT a.group#, b.member, a.status FROM v$log a, v$logfile b WHERE a.group#=b.group#; 1.9 服务器参数文件,并重数据库...-- 在ASM磁盘组创建服务器参数文件 SQL> create spfile='+DATA1' from pfile='/tmp/pfile.ora'; -- 正常关闭数据库 SQL> shutdown.../dbs/initjingyu.ora,编辑内容指定ASM磁盘组的服务器参数文件。

    91220

    Oracle11安装和卸载教程

    2、 开始->程序->Oracle - OraDb11g_home1->Oracle安装产品-> Universal Installer 卸装所有Oracle产品,但Universal Installer...6、 开始->设置->控制面板->系统->高级->环境变量 删除环境变量CLASSPATH和PATH中有关Oracle的设定 7、 桌面上、STARTUP(启动)组、程序菜单删除所有有关...Oracle,删除这个 口目录及所有子目录,并从Windows目录(一般为C:\WINDOWS)下删除oralce文件等等。...WIN.INI文件若有[ORACLE]的标记段,删除该段 12、 【如有必要】,删除所有Oracle相关的ODBC的DSN 13、 到事件查看器删除Oracle相关的日志 说明: 如果有个别DLL...文件无法删除的情况,则不用理会,重新启动,开始新的安装, 安装时,选择一个新的目录,则,安装完毕并重新启动后,老的目录及文件就可以删除掉了

    1.4K80

    oracle10g冷备份和恢复过程记录

    3、记录下oralce的版本号、安装路径、数据库名(可以在pfile文件查看到)、实例名保证后续重建数据库的时候配置和原数据库统一。 4、到此冷备份结束。...5、接着将移动硬盘备份的admin目录,pfile目录,spfile文件,(控制文件,数据文件,日志文件)都覆盖掉新装的oralce的对应的目录和文件; 6、进入sqlplus,输入命令: recover...database using backup controlfile until cancel; 在输出的内容后面,敲redo日志文件的绝对路径,然后回车,如果没有成功,就换一个redo...五、待验证的想法:其实很可能不需要重新安装oralce,也能恢复数据,具体做法如下: 1、不要删除原来的oralce安装目录; 2、tnsnames.ora 和listener.ora文件换成初始状态;...\assistants\dbca\dbca.cl 4、在打开数据库创建向导,建立一个数据库,其名称和路径要和原数据库保持一致; 5、之后的操作同上面的5、6、7; 6、运行命令,打开监听创建向导:

    76740

    Django | 页面数据的缓存与使用

    开销处理的角度来看,这比你读取一个现成的标准文件的代价要昂贵的多 使用缓存,将多用户访问时基本相同的数据先缓存起来;这样当用户访问页面的时候,不需要重新计算数据,而是直接从缓存里读取,避免性能上的开销...使用Redis数据库 使用redis数据库存储缓存,首先redis是key-value类型的数据库,NoSQL,且也是内存型数据库,redis是将数据加载到内存,进行操作,并异步将数据备份到硬盘里。...而我们知道,内存的读取速度要比硬盘的读取速度快,因此Redis的读取速度要比其他文件型数据库快很多。...例子 在视图类或视图函数,首先先别急着计算页面数据;而是先向缓存读取该页面的数据;若返回一个None;说明没有缓存或缓存的数据已经过期;此时才需要进行数据库查询等计算服务 并将更新后的数据写入缓存,...因此,继承并重写该方法,并在里面添加 删除缓存的代码,则网站管理员通过自带管理页面修改数据时,旧的页面缓存会被清除 如: class BaseModel(admin.ModelAdmin):

    1.9K40
    领券